Nathaniel Stedman 1665–1703 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1665

Birth Location: Cambridge, Middlesex, Massachusetts, USA

Death Date: Jul 1703

Death Location: Muddy River,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Nathaniel Stedman

Mother: Temperance WILLIS-

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Nathaniel Stedman was born in 1665 in Cambridge, Middlesex, Massachusetts, USA, the child of Nathaniel Stedman And Temperance Willis. Nathaniel Stedman passed away in 1703 in Muddy River, Massachusetts, USA.
